Frequently Asked Questions

What is the population and demographic makeup of Hoke County?

The total population of Hoke County is approximately 53,835. The community has a large population of young adults (18-34). This demographic data is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Is Hoke County walkable and transit-friendly?

Based on local geographic data, Hoke County has an amenity and walkability score of 44/100 and a transit score of 44/100. This indicates moderate access to local amenities and transportation.

Do more people rent or own homes in Hoke County?

The housing market in Hoke County is predominantly driven by homeowners, with 73% of housing units being owner-occupied and 27% being renter-occupied.
